English: Figure 12.
Distal portion of anterior region of carapace showing relative difference in size of pigmented area of cornea among aeglids: Grade 0 (fully developed) in the epigean species Aegla perobae (A) and in the stygophilic species A. strinatii (B). Grade 1 (slightly reduced) in the stygobitic species A. charon n. sp. (C), and A. leptochela (D). Grade 2 (greatly reduced) in the stygobitic species A. cavernicola (E). Grade 3 (absent) in the stygobitic species A. microphthalma (F). All species are endemic to Alto Ribeira karst region, except A. perobae, which is endemic to the Tietê Hydrographic Basin. Scale bars = 2.0 mm.
